Job Description:

Job Title: Fast and Fresh Department Manager

Department: Fast and Fresh

FLSA: Non-Exempt

General Function

Sets the department standards for customer service, employee relations, cleanliness, sanitation, professional appearance and overall profitability. Presents the best quality product at a competitive retail price to customers.

Core Competencies

  • Partnerships
  • Growth mindset
  • Results oriented
  • Customer focused
  • Professionalism

Reporting Relations

Accountable and Reports to: District Store Director, Store Manager, Assistant Managers of; Store Operations, Perishables, and Health Wellness Home

Positions that Report to you: Fast and Fresh Department Employees

Primary Duties and Responsibilities

  • Maintains a positive attitude; creates an atmosphere of friendliness and fun through flexibility and teamwork.
  • Generates a friendly atmosphere by encouraging employees to greet and speak to customers; providing prompt, courteous, and efficient service to customers and sets a good example.
  • Sets the department standards for customer service, employee relations, cleanliness, sanitation, professional appearance and overall profitability.
  • Provides prompt, efficient and friendly customer service by exhibiting caring, concern and patience in all customer interactions and treating customers as the most important people in the store.
  • Smiles and greets customers in a friendly manner, whether the encounter takes place in the employee’s designated department or elsewhere in the store.
  • Makes an effort to learn customers’ names and to address them by name whenever possible.
  • Assists customers by: (examples include)
    • escorting them to the products they’re looking for
    • securing products that are out of reach
    • loading or unloading heavy items
    • making note of and passing along customer suggestions or requests
    • performing other tasks in every way possible to enhance the shopping experience.
  • Answers the telephone promptly and provides friendly, helpful service to customers who call.
  • Recruits, hires, trains, supervises, disciplines, and evaluates all department employees.
  • Determines department goals with store director.
  • Writes department work schedule and establishes a daily work plan for the department.
  • Inspects signage and displays for quality and quantity of merchandise and orders product for replenishment.
  • Communicates with employees regarding sales and ideas.
  • Handles and satisfies customer issues.
  • Figures retail pricing and ensures correct pricing.
  • Extends invoices, posts invoices, and oversees department bookkeeping procedures.
  • Analyzes weekly and monthly sales and trends and compares to actuals, prepares ad projections, and writes ads.
  • Conducts inventory of the department.
  • Plans displays, promotions, and determines pre-orders.
  • Ensures proper temperatures and storage procedures are maintained to guarantee freshness and control shrink of product.
  • Understands and troubleshoots equipment and ensures maintenance is performed.
  • Maintains strict adherence to department and company guidelines related to personal hygiene and dress.
  • Adheres to company policies and individual store guidelines.
  • Reports to work when scheduled and works expected number of hours.

Secondary Duties and Responsibilities

  • Ensures pricing is competitive in the market area.
  • Attends meetings and seminars and participates in continuing education.
  • Fills displays and works in the sales area.
  • Unloads trucks, checks in delivered merchandise and places product in appropriate storage area.
  •  Performs departmental duties as needed.
  • Assists in other areas of the store as needed.
  • Performs other job related duties and special projects as required.

Knowledge, Skills, Abilities and Worker Characteristics

  • Must have the ability to solve practical problems; variety of variables with limited standardization; interpret instructions.
  • Ability to do arithmetic calculations involving fractions, decimals, and percentages.
  • Must have the ability to file, post, and mail materials; copy data from one record to another; interview to obtain basic information; guide people and provide basic direction.

Education and Experience

High School or over one year of related work experience.

Supervisory Responsibilities

  • Instructs, assigns, reviews and plans work of others.
  • Maintains standards, coordinates activities, allocates personnel, acts on employee problems, and selects new employees.
  • Has the authority to approve employee discipline.
  • Has the authority to recommend employee transfer, discharge, and salary increases.

Physical Requirements

  • Must be able to physically perform medium work: exerting up to 50 pounds of force occasionally and 20 pounds of force frequently, and 10 pounds of force constantly to move objects.
  • Visual requirements include vision from less than 20 inches to more than 20 feet with or without correction, depth perception, color vision, and field of vision.
  • Must be able to perform the following physical activities: Climbing, balancing, stooping, kneeling, reaching, standing, walking, pulling, lifting, grasping, feeling, talking, hearing, and repetitive motions.

Working Conditions

This position is frequently exposed to temperature extremes and dampness. There are possible equipment movement hazards, electrical shock, and exposure to cleaning chemicals and solvents. This is a fast paced work environment.

Equipment Used to Perform Job

Telephone, fax, copier, pallet jacks, garbage disposal, trash compactor, cardboard compactor, box cutter, knives, computer, calculator, frozen juice machine, coffee maker, cash register, RPM, gas pumps.

Financial Responsibility

Responsible for company assets, including equipment and merchandise.

Contacts

Daily contact with customers, employees, suppliers/vendors, and the general public. Occasional contact with local, federal or state regulatory agencies regarding inspections.

Confidentiality

Has access to confidential information including, employee compensation, monthly results, quarterly inventory reports, sales and profit sheets, and warehouse pricing.
